In the QS World University Global MBA Rankings 2024, twelve Indian HEIs have been ranked among the top 250 Asian institutions. The twelve Indian colleges to accomplish this are: Indian School of Business (ISB), Hyderabad; International Management Institute, Delhi; Management Development Institute, Gurugram; Xavier School of Management, Jamshedpur; IMT Ghaziabad; Jagdish Sheth School of Management (JAGSoM); IIM Bangalore; IIM Ahmedabad; IIM Calcutta; IIM Indore; IIM Lucknow; IIM Udaipur.
With an overall score of 68.5, IIM Bangalore has attained the highest position, coming in at 48th place. The institute, which is ranked 31st, has also appeared among the top 50 for return on investment. IIM Ahmedabad and ISB Hyderabad rank in the top 50 for alumni outcomes and entrepreneurship according to QS. The ISB is ranked 43rd, whereas IIM Ahmedabad is ranked 33rd and second in Asia. ISB, Hyderabad is placed 78th, whereas IIM Indore, IIM Lucknow, and IIM Udaipur are ranked between 151-200. In addition to this, the rankings for the Jagdish Sheth School of Management (JAGSoM) and the Institute of Management Technology, Ghaziabad, are included in the list.
The MBA program at Stanford GSB has topped the list, with programs at The Wharton School and Harvard Business School coming in second and third.
